Benzo(a)pyreneAbbreviated B(a)P. A member of a class of compounds known as pol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s). The metabolites of B(a)P are mutagenic and highly carcinogenic. When the body tries to metabolize B(a)P, the resulting compounds react and bind to DNA which results in mutations and eventually cancer.

Benzo(a)pyreneA potent mutagen and carcinogen. It is a Public Health concern because of its possible effects on industrial workers, as an environmental pollutant, an as a component of Tobacco smoke.
